🌱 So, What Is Lemon Balm Tea?
It’s a leafy green herb from the mint family, but instead of tasting like toothpaste, it has this fresh lemony scent that feels instantly calming.
People have been using it for centuries — especially in Europe — for stress, digestion, and sleep. I’d just never thought to try it until I needed something gentle but effective.

🫖 How I Make It (And When I Drink It)
It’s super simple:
-
1 heaping tsp of dried lemon balm
-
Hot water (not boiling)
-
Cover and steep for 8–10 mins
-
Strain and sip slow
Sometimes I add chamomile or a slice of ginger if I need something extra. My go-to time? After lunch (instead of that third coffee), or an hour before bed if I’ve had a long day.
🛑 A Quick Heads-Up
Lemon balm is pretty gentle and safe, but:
-
If you’re on thyroid meds, ask your doc first
-
Don’t overdo it — more isn’t always better
-
Pregnant or nursing? Better to check with your provider
